Convoy Logistics Advantages

Convoy logistics offer several advantages, primarily in the form of cost savings and operational efficiency. By grouping shipments together, businesses can maximize truckload utilization, reducing the number of trips required and ultimately saving on fuel and labor costs. For example, consider a company that typically ships partial loads twice a week. By adopting a convoy approach, this company could consolidate these shipments into a single full load, cutting transport costs by up to 20%.

Moreover, convoys can enhance predictability and reliability in delivery schedules. When trucks travel together, they can maintain consistent speeds, reducing the likelihood of delays. This is particularly beneficial for time-sensitive shipments where the Final dispatch cut-off is critical, such as medical supplies. Here, a convoy strategy ensures that all units arrive simultaneously, maintaining the integrity of the supply chain.

A practical lever for managers is setting an On-time delivery rate target of 95% or higher. This KPI ensures that the convoy logistics strategy is not only reducing costs but also meeting customer expectations. For instance, a food distribution company using convoys can meet its delivery commitments more reliably, thus enhancing customer satisfaction and loyalty.

Fuel Efficiency Strategies

Fuel efficiency is a critical consideration in convoy logistics, not only for cost savings but also for environmental impact. Convoys can improve fuel efficiency by reducing air resistance, as closely grouped vehicles create a slipstream effect. This can lead to fuel savings of up to 10%, a significant reduction when scaled across a fleet.

To optimize these gains, companies can implement eco-driving training for drivers, emphasizing the importance of maintaining steady speeds and minimizing sudden accelerations. Additionally, investing in aerodynamic truck designs further enhances efficiency. Consider a scenario where a logistics company invests in streamlined trailers; the immediate impact is a noticeable reduction in fuel consumption, leading to long-term cost savings.

A practitioner lever for enhancing fuel efficiency is setting a target Fuel Efficiency Ratio of ≥ 7 mpg (≈ 33.6 liters per 100 km) for the fleet. This KPI helps ensure that fuel savings are realized and maintained over time. For example, a transportation company that achieves this ratio consistently will see significant cost reductions, contributing to a more sustainable operation.

Risk Management Approaches

Despite the benefits, convoy logistics also introduce unique risks that must be managed effectively. These include increased potential for accidents due to the proximity of vehicles and heightened coordination requirements. However, with proper risk management strategies, these challenges can be mitigated.

Implementing advanced driver-assistance systems (ADAS) can significantly reduce collision risks. Such systems provide automatic braking and lane-keeping assistance, which are crucial when vehicles travel in close formation. Furthermore, establishing clear communication protocols ensures that drivers are aware of any changes in the convoy’s route or speed, reducing the likelihood of errors.

For instance, a logistics company might set a Collision Incident Rate threshold of <2% for its convoy operations. This KPI helps monitor and manage risks, ensuring that safety remains a top priority. In a scenario where a convoy encounters unexpected road conditions, ADAS can prevent accidents, maintaining the safety and efficiency of the operation.

In addition, companies must account for regulatory and operational constraints such as driver Hours-of-Service limits, minimum following distances, and platooning restrictions in certain regions. Establishing clear “break and merge” procedures ensures safety compliance during convoy operations.

Cost-Benefit Analysis

Conducting a cost-benefit analysis is essential before implementing a convoy strategy. This involves assessing the initial investment in technology and training against the potential savings in fuel and labor costs. A simple rule-of-thumb formula for evaluating this is: ROI = (Annual Savings – Initial Investment) ÷ Initial Investment. If the ROI exceeds 15%, the investment is typically considered worthwhile.

For instance, a company contemplating the shift to convoy logistics might calculate that the required technology upgrades would cost $100,000, but the projected annual savings in fuel and labor would be $150,000. The resulting ROI of 50% strongly supports the transition, making a compelling case for adopting convoy logistics.

Convoy Operations Playbook

To ensure convoy logistics operate efficiently and safely, managers can adopt the following operational playbook:

  • Dispatch cut-off time: set a unified deadline for forming convoys (e.g., Friday 17:00).

  • Gap policy: maintain safe following distances, adjusted for weather and terrain.

  • Alert SLA: respond to any telematics or geofence alert within 15 minutes.

  • Break/Merge protocol: define clear communication and re-entry steps for drivers.

  • Fuel KPI set: maintain Fuel Variance < 12% and Fleet Efficiency ≥ 7 mpg (≈ 33.6 L/100 km).

  • Safety gate: keep Collision Incident Rate below 2% and perform ADAS checks before departure.
